The Organizing Committee for the Virtual Stamp Show has confirmed three more distinguished speakers, who will present at the event, held online from August 17-22, 2020.
Frank Walton
“The Global Philatelic Library Project”
Frank Walton is a distinguished author, editor, exhibitor and international philatelic judge. Frank was president of the Royal Philatelic Society London from 2015-2017 and past editor of The London Philatelist from July 2001-December 2017. He is a Fellow of the RSPL and in 2015 became a signatory to the Roll of Distinguished Philatelists.
Walton’s collecting interests and area of specialization in philately concerns Sierra Leone which in turn lead to his assuming the position of Honorary Editor of Cameo, the journal of the West Africa Study Circle, from 1996. He has published numerous books and over 200 articles in specialist and national journals.
Frank has also been deeply involved in a number of other philatelic projects such as the Global Philatelic Library as well as serving on a number of philatelic committees including as a member of the organizing committee of London 2010 International Stamp Exhibition, as Commissioner General of London 2015 Europhilex and currently as the Chairman for the London 2020 (now 2022) International Stamp Exhibition show.
Nancy Stahl
"Postage Stamp Illustration"
Nancy Stahl is an celebrated illustrator who lives in New York City. She attended Art Center College of Design in Los Angeles and also studied at School of Visual Arts. She has worked in a career split equally between traditional media and digitally created art. In 1989 she was also invited to Adobe’s headquarters to test a pre-release of the original Photoshop. She began to work exclusively on the computer two years later.
Nancy’s assignments have ranged from editorial work for The New York Times, The Wall Street Journal, and Time magazine to corporate identity, packaging and advertising for diverse companies including: The Disney Family Museum, Stonyfield Farms, Time-Life Music, and the National Parks Service. She has also created work for the Metropolitan Museum of Art’s Costume Institute and the US Postal Service, which has used over thirty-five of her illustrations on postage stamps.
In 2012, Nancy was elected to the Society of Illustrators Hall of Fame. Her work has appeared in solo and group exhibitions in the US and abroad.
Dr. Frederick P. Lawrence
"Facsimiles and Forgeries of the 1920 Siam (Thailand) 'Scout’s Fund' Overprints”
Frederick P. Lawrence has been collecting stamps since 1960, when he earned the Boy Scouts stamp collecting merit badge. During the 60's and 70's, he formed one of the most complete collections of Scouts and Guides on stamps in existence at the time. In the early 80's he focused his collecting interests on the three earliest Scouts on stamps issues: 1900 Cape of Good Hope Mafeking siege photographic ("blueprint") stamps, 1918 Czechoslovakia Scout Post issue, and 1920-1921 Siam "Scout's Fund" overprints. Dr. Lawrence is a member of the APS, RPSL, AAPE, SOSSI, SGSC, ABWPS, and TPS, the President of STP, and a Director of SCP. He has served as a US Commissioner for an international philatelic exhibition and as awards chairman, exhibits chairman, societies liaison, and jury coordinator for a US national-level, WSP-qualifying shows.
